Description

Elevate Multi Academy Trust consisting of 11 Schools in North Yorkshire and 1 School in West Yorkshire, have decided to tender their primary school catering services to investigate the financial and qualitative benefits they could be offered as a group. The Schools involved are: - • Meadowside Academy, Knaresborough • Aspin Park Academy, Knaresborough • Knayton C of E Academy • Topcliffe C of E Academy • Sowerby Primary Academy • Carlton Miniott Academy • Keeble Gateway • Marton-cum-Grafton C of E Primary School • Knaresborough St John C of E Primary School, Knaresborough • Thornton Dale C of E Primary • Rillington Community Primary School • Thorner C of E Primary School

Total Quantity or Scope

Within this tender, Elevate Multi Academy Trust wish to establish a Framework Agreement with the winning Contractor, to enable other Schools who enter the Trust to call upon the agreed catering service level should they wish to engage the Contractor's services throughout the duration of the Contract. Such call offs will be agreed through a Commissioning Letter as attached in the Framework Agreement. The Contract Duration and Structure The Contract and Framework Agreement will be awarded for a three-year duration with the option of two additional one-year extensions. Each School will sign a separate agreement with the successful tendering organisation. It is the intention of the Trust to appoint a single contractor. The Trust 's main aims for the new contract are to have a catering service that: • Offers food that consistently looks and tastes appetising and is attractively presented. • Encourages pupils to take a heathy and balanced meal and menus are suitable for a primary school. • Provides food that fully complies with the Government Standards. The schools feel treat days and sessions do work well and encourage uptake generally. Consultation with each school is to be encouraged however the health eating requirements should be the focus of menus. • Encourages a higher number of pupils to use the lunch service where appropriate (see details on the individual Schools below) including all those entitled to free meals. • Consultation with the parents and pupils to illicit feedback. • Is operated by a catering team who are reliable, well-motivated, managed, trained and developed. • Is managed by a strong contractor area manager, who will develop and lead the team to deliver a customer service focused offer and spend a substantial amount of time on site, especially at the outset, to facilitate this. • Is proactively managed and requires minimal management from the Schools' leadership teams. • Facilitates a dining experience for the pupils that is pleasurable and calm and positively encourages the eating of all their food and developing good table manners and social skills. The idea that the pupil is treated by the catering team in the same manner as they would treat their own children at home. • Shares best practices between Schools and catering teams about all aspects of the catering service • Develops a community food provision that extends to staff, parents, visitors, and the immediate neighbourhood and promotes food education for all stakeholders. • Is professionally marketed and promoted to the mutual benefit of the pupils, parents, Schools, and contractor. • Demonstrates a flexible approach to all School activities and supports aspects of the curriculum as appropriate, including positively contributing to the education of pupils about food and nutrition. • Is managed by an organisation who works with the Schools in partnership to move the service forward together. • Achieves best value and eliminates any subsidies as far as is realistically possible.
